102, Ropewalk Court Derby Road, Nottingham, NG1 5AD is a leasehold flat built between 1991-1995. The property offers approximately 614 square feet of living space and is situated on the 4th flo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£142,765 , which equates to approximately £233 per square foot. It was last sold on 13 Nov 2019 for £112,000. Since then, the value has increased by £30,765, representing a 27.5% increase, or approximately 4.5% per year.

The current estimated value of £142,765 is:

  • 64.1% lower than the average property price on Derby Road
  • 26.7% lower than the average in the NG1 5AD postcode area
  • and 53.9% lower than the average price for Nottingham as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 9 May 2019,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

102, Ropewalk Court Derby Road, Nottingham, City Of Nottingham, NG1 5AD has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 9 May 2019.

This property uses electric storage heaters as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from off-peak electric immersion heater.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 5 May 2010. The rating of C is unchanged, though the energy efficiency score decreased by 3.8%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ency improving from poor to average, while the heating system type remained the same (electric storage heaters).
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to very good.
